How to Enable AI Translation in RetroArch (G11 Pro Console)

AI Translation allows you to translate on-screen game text into English in real-time using an overlay - perfect for games that aren’t in your native language.

Step-by-Step Guide:

  1. Start any game using RetroArch.
  2. Press both joysticks together >This opens the RetroArch menu.
  3. Press the B button to go back to the main settings menu.
  4. Scroll and select Settings.
  5. Inside Settings, go to AI Service.
  6. Enable the option: Enable AI Service → turn it ON. 
  7. Set translation URL to - http://ztransalate.net/services
  8. Set the Service Mode to your preferred option: Image to Text (Overlay) - Recommended for most users
  9. Choose your Target Language (e.g., English). Note: Leave Source Language as default - RetroArch will auto-detect when possible.
  10. Go back to Settings, then select Inputs > Hotkeys
  11. Scroll down to AI Service > Press "A" and then the button you want to use as your translation trigger (example: R3 or L3+R3).
  12. Exit the menu and return to your game.

How to Use AI Translation In-Game:

  • When you see non-English text, press the hotkey you set
  • RetroArch will capture that part of the screen and show the translated text as an on-screen overlay

Notes:

  • Your console must be connected to the internet
  • Works best on games with clear on-screen text
